Google Cloud Top-up without Credit Card Google Cloud GCP Site Account Setup Process
Getting Started with Google Cloud Platform (GCP): The Ultimate Setup Guide
\nCongratulations! You’ve decided to dip your toes into the expansive ocean of cloud computing by setting up a Google Cloud Platform (GCP) account. Whether you’re a developer, a startup owner, or just someone curious about the cloud, this step-by-step guide will walk you through the entire process with a sprinkle of humor, a dash of clarity, and a whole lot of helpful tips. Buckle up, because cloud setup has never been this fun—or this straightforward.
\n\nStep 1: Create Your Google Account
\nWhy a Google Account?
\nThe first thing you need is a Google account. Think of this as your ticket into the cloud, the password to your digital kingdom. If you already have a Gmail or YouTube account, you’re in luck—you can use that! If not, go ahead and create a fresh account. It’s free, easy, and takes less time than it does to brew a cup of coffee.
\nHow to Create a Google Account
\n- \n
- Head over to https://accounts.google.com/signup \n
- Fill in your personal details — name, username, password, and recovery options (because sometimes we forget things... like why we walked into a room). \n
- Verify your phone number to make sure you’re not a robot trying to take over the world. \n
- Agree to Google’s terms and conditions, and voilà—you’re a Google account owner. \n
Well done! Now that you have a Google account, you’re ready to conquer the cloud.
\n\nStep 2: Sign Up for Google Cloud Platform
\nAccessing Google Cloud Console
\nNavigate to the Google Cloud Console. If you’re not signed in, it will prompt you to do so. Sign in using your shiny new Google account credentials.
\nGetting Familiar with the Dashboard
\nOnce inside, you’ll see a dashboard that looks a bit like the cockpit of a spaceship—lots of buttons, menus, and options. Don’t worry! We'll go through the essentials step-by-step.
\nEnable Billing
\nGoogle Cloud Top-up without Credit Card Before you get too excited and create a million instances, you need to set up billing. Don’t panic—Google offers a free tier that provides $300 in credits for 90 days, which is enough for beginners or hobbyists. To do this:
\n- \n
- Click on the hamburger menu (the three lines in the top-left corner). \n
- Select "Billing". \n
- Follow the prompts to set up a billing account—enter your payment info, but remember, you won’t be charged until your credits run out. \n
With billing sorted, your account is practically ready for action.
\n\nStep 3: Creating Your First Project
\nWhy Projects Matter
\nIn GCP, projects are like folders in your digital filing cabinet. They organize resources, permissions, and settings. Think of it as creating a dedicated space for your current big idea or experiment.
\nHow to Create a Project
\n- \n
- Click on the project dropdown menu in the top bar where it likely says “Select a Project”. \n
- Select “NEW PROJECT”. \n
- Name your project—preferably something descriptive and fun, like \"My First Cloud Adventure\". \n
- Google Cloud Top-up without Credit Card Pick an organization if you’re part of one, or leave it as “No organization”. \n
- Click “Create”. \n
Voila! You’ve just created your first sandbox to play, develop, or experiment in.
\n\nStep 4: Enabling Necessary APIs
\nWhy APIs?
\nAPIs (Application Programming Interfaces) are like messengers that let your applications talk to Google Cloud services. To do anything useful—like deploy websites or run data analysis—you’ll need to enable relevant APIs.
\nEnabling APIs
\n- \n
- From your project dashboard, click on “APIs & Services” on the left menu. \n
- Select “Library”. \n
- Browse or search for APIs you need, like “Compute Engine” or “Cloud Storage”. \n
- Click on the API and then “Enable”. \n
Rinse and repeat for any other services you plan to use. Remember: enabling APIs is like installing apps on your smartphone—necessary before you can start using them.
\n\nStep 5: Setting Up Access and Permissions
\nCreating Service Accounts
\nIf you plan to automate tasks or give access to teammates, setting up a service account is essential. Think of these as special user accounts just for backend processes or team members.
\nHow to Create a Service Account
\n- \n
- Navigate to “IAM & Admin” > “Service Accounts”. \n
- Click “Create Service Account”. \n
- Name your service account (something clear like “DeploymentBot”). \n
- Assign roles—start with basic Editor, but specify more granular permissions as needed. \n
- Click “Create”. \n
Now your service account is ready to talk to GCP services securely—and without user intervention.
\n\nStep 6: Security Best Practices
\nKeep Your Keys Safe
\nDownload your private keys securely and store them in a password-protected folder. Don’t leave them lying around in public repositories—security first, always!
\nEnable Two-Factor Authentication
\nMake your account a fortress by turning on 2FA to block unauthorized access, even if someone manages to guess your password.
\nReview Permissions Regularly
\nOnly give permissions what’s necessary. The principle of least privilege is your best friend in cloud security.
\n\nFinal Thoughts: You're Ready to Launch!
\nThere you have it—the entire process of setting up your Google Cloud Platform site account from scratch. It might seem complex at first, but step by step, it’s just a series of clicks and input forms. Now, with your account ready, the real fun begins—deploying apps, hosting websites, or exploring the infinite possibilities cloud computing has to offer. Remember, don’t be intimidated by all the technical jargon; think of it as building a digital Lego set. Happy clouding!
" }

